I'm building a new house and I'm woundering what is the best setup for a brand new installation?
Do I still need coax to each receiver? Does FiOS have wireless installations? Do I only need Coax to the DVR? Please give me some advice for what to do during building to make it easy when installing FiOS in the new home.

Coax every room you want service of any type now and in the future...use RG6

Anything other than Fios Quantum TV IPC have to have coax. Older cable boxes and the new VMS boxes which are part of FQTV need coax for now. IPC's for FQTV need either coax or ethernet connection to the router.
